NordVPN has a unique feature called SmartPlay. It unblocks over 150 streaming services by bypassing geo-restrictions. You can access Netflix, Hulu, Amazon Prime, and other popular streaming services. One of the newest NordVPN features is the WifiSec – NordVPN will automatically initiate a VPN connection whenever a Wi-Fi network is joined. It can be set up to auto-connect to Nord on both secured and unsecured Wi-Fi networks. This will help users feel more secure when connecting to unknown networks. It really is a no-brainer choice.
